A ballistic curved panel satisfying the NIJ0101.06 level III standard and a preparation method thereof

By combining a curing layer, an 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el, a hot melt adhesive film layer, and a dent-reducing material layer, and using a four-column hydraulic press heat sealing technology, the problems of high surface density and deep dents in the bulletproof curved panel are solved, achieving bulletproof performance that meets the N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ention belongs to the field of bulletproof curved panel technology, specifically relating to a bulletproof curved panel that meets the N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ard and its preparation method. Background Technology

[0002] Polyethylene (PE) inserts typically weigh between 1 and 1.5 kg, significantly lighter than steel and ceramic inserts. However, due to current limitations in material processing, the highest protection level achievable with pure PE inserts is NIJ Level III, insufficient to protect against armor-piercing rifle rounds and bullets with greater power. Composite PE ballistic plates offer improved performance, but the areal density of plates manufactured using current technology is around 17 kg / m³. 2 The above; Patent CN202022496929.1 discloses a bulletproof structure, including: a bulletproof layer, the bulletproof layer comprising a multi-layer 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ber woven structure, the weaving direction of adjacent two layers of the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ber woven structure being arranged at 90°, and the areal density of the bulletproof layer being 50 g / m³. 2 -60g / m 2 The ballistic protection layer includes an anti-dent layer disposed on the back surface of the ballistic protection layer, comprising a multi-layered microfiber three-dimensional woven structure; the final dent result of the second ballistic protection structure is 26.0 mm, with a theoretical areal density of 19.26 kg / m³. 2 Patent CN202011325268.4 describes a composite bulletproof insert comprising a PE laminate, an aramid fabric transition layer, bulletproof ceramic, and an aramid fabric crack-resistant layer, arranged sequentially from the back plate to the front plate. The composite bulletproof insert weighs no more than 2.8 kg and has a surface density of no more than 35 kg / m³. 2 The thickness does not exceed 22mm. There is no existing technology that meets the N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ard and has a surface density of less than 17kg / m³. 2 Bulletproof curved panels. Summary of the Invention

[0003] The purpose of this invention is to provide a bulletproof curved panel that meets the N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ard and its preparation method, so as to solve the problems of high surface density and deep indentation of current bulletproof curved panels.

[0004] The content of this invention includes:

[0005] A bulletproof curved panel meeting N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ard comprises, from the outside to the inside, a curing layer, an 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el, a hot melt adhesive film layer, and a dent-reducing material layer; the dent-reducing material layer is composed of one of the following: carbon fiber woven fabric, aramid woven fabric, carbon fiber nonwoven fabric, aramid nonwoven fabric, carbon fiber-aramid blended woven fabric, or carbon fiber-aramid blended nonwoven fabric; the areal density of the dent-reducing material is 150-450 g / m³. 2 The thickness is 0.2-0.5mm.

[0006] Furthermore, the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el has an areal density of 105-125 g / m³. 2 It is made of 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ene nonwoven fabric.

[0007] Furthermore, the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ene nonwoven fabric, after layout, cutting, weighting, and pressing, achieves an areal density of 12.4-12.5 kg / m². 2 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el.

[0008] Furthermore, the counterweight is achieved by selecting each piece of cut non-woven fabric, removing fabric samples with insects, impurities, defects, etc., and then stacking and piling the fabric samples according to the specified surface density.

[0009] Furthermore, the cured layer is made of one of aramid, glass fiber, or 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ber.

[0010] Furthermore, the hot melt adhesive film layer is one of PO, TPU or EVA.

[0011] Furthermore, the main component of the PO hot melt adhesive film is polyolefin; the TPU hot melt adhesive, also known as TPU hot melt double-sided adhesive, is mainly composed of polyurethane; and the main component of the EVA hot melt adhesive film is vinyl acetate copolymer.

[0012] Furthermore, the surface density of the bulletproof curved panel is ≤15kg / m³. 2 It can withstand 6 rounds of M80 bullets, resulting in a dent of ≤40mm.

[0013] A method for preparing a ballistic curved panel that meets the NIJ0101.06 Level 3 standard includes the following steps:

[0014] (1) Assemble the curing layer, 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el, hot melt adhesive film layer and anti-dent material layer in sequence, put them into a sealed bag and seal them, and then vacuum them;

[0015] (2) Place the above-mentioned sealed bag into a four-column hydraulic press for heat sealing;

[0016] (3) Spray paint onto the heat-sealed material, air dry and let it stand to form a bulletproof curved panel.

[0017] Furthermore, the operating process of the four-column hydraulic press in step (2) is as follows:

[0018] Within 0-30 minutes, the pressure reaches 18 MPa and the temperature reaches 75-80℃;

[0019] 31-45 minutes, maintain temperature and pressure for 15 minutes;

[0020] 45-55 minutes, pressure reaches 22 MPa, temperature reaches 115-125℃;

[0021] 56-120 min, maintain temperature and pressure for 65 minutes;

[0022] 121-180 minutes, release the pressure and lower the temperature to room temperature.

[0023] Furthermore, in step (3), the paint is black polyurea component B: black polyurea component A = 1.2:0.8; the nozzle diameter for spraying is Ф1.2mm, and the spraying distance is 550~630mm.

[0024] Furthermore, in step (3), the paint spraying temperature is 65~70℃, and the air drying and settling time is 5~6 hours.

[0025] The beneficial effects of this invention are:

[0026] (1) In terms of preparation process, this method is simple, easy to operate, and highly efficient;

[0027] (2) In terms of effectiveness, the surface density of the bulletproof curved panel produced by this method does not exceed 15 kg / m³. 2 It can withstand 6 M80 bullets and the dent should not exceed 40mm (refer to NIJ0101.06 Level III standard), which is at an advanced level in China. Attached Figure Description

[0028] Figure 1 This is a schematic diagram of the structure of the present invention. 1 is the curing layer, 2 is the 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el, 3 is the hot melt adhesive film, and 4 is the anti-dent material. Detailed Implementation

[0029] Example 1

[0030] (1) Preparation of 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ene bulletproof curved panel

[0031] Select an areal density of 110 g / m³ 2 The 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ene nonwoven fabric is laid on the workbench, requiring the fabric to be laid flat and each layer to overlap.

[0032] Using specialized software for clothing design, the pattern is automatically laid out and cut according to the dimensions of the bulletproof inserts;

[0033] The cut material sheets are promptly transported to the counterweight room for balancing, with the areal density controlled within the range of 12.4-12.5 kg / m³. 2 .

[0034] (2) Select anti-sag materials and hot melt adhesive film

[0035] Choose a thickness of 0.3mm and a surface density of 300g / m³. 2 Carbon fiber woven fabric was used as the anti-dent material; EVA hot melt adhesive film was selected.

[0036] (3) Enter the four-column hydraulic press for heat sealing

[0037] Using 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ene fiber as the curing layer, bulletproof curved panel, hot melt adhesive film, and anti-dent material, according to... Figure 1 The structure is assembled and then placed on the loading platform. The assembled raw materials are sealed with a sealing bag, and then a vacuum operation is performed to confirm that the sealing bag is not damaged. Finally, the sealing bag is placed into a four-column hydraulic press for heat sealing.

[0038] The operating process of a four-column hydraulic press is as follows:

[0039] Within 0-30 minutes, the pressure reached 18 MPa and the temperature reached 78℃;

[0040] 31-45 minutes, maintain temperature and pressure for 15 minutes;

[0041] 45-55 minutes, pressure reaches 22 MPa, temperature reaches 120℃;

[0042] 56-120 min, maintain temperature and pressure for 65 minutes;

[0043] 121-180 minutes, release the pressure and lower the temperature to room temperature;

[0044] A semi-finished product was obtained.

[0045] (4) Bulletproof curved panel spraying molding

[0046] Preparation: Paint (black polyurea component B): Hardener (black polyurea component A) = 1.2:0.8. Heat the paint to 68℃ using equipment and begin spraying. Use a nozzle diameter of Ф1.2mm and a spraying distance of 600mm to evenly spray the product surface. Finally, allow it to air dry and stand for 5.5 hours to form the bulletproof plate.

[0047] Example 2

[0048] Choose a thickness of 0.2mm and a surface density of 200g / m³. 2 Using aramid nonwoven fabric as the dent reduction material, and with the other conditions the same as in Example 1, a bulletproof curved panel was obtained.

[0049] Example 3

[0050] Choose a surface density of 120 g / m³ 2 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ene (UHMWPE) bulletproof curved panels were prepared using UHMWPE non-woven fabric, with other procedures the same as in Example 1, to obtain bulletproof curved panels.

[0051] Example 4

[0052] Select a TPU type hot melt adhesive film, and follow the same procedure as in Example 1 to obtain a bulletproof curved panel.

[0053] Example 5

[0054] The operating process of a four-column hydraulic press is as follows:

[0055] Within 0-30 minutes, the pressure reaches 18 MPa and the temperature reaches 75℃;

[0056] 31-45 minutes, maintain temperature and pressure for 15 minutes;

[0057] 45-55 minutes, the pressure reaches 22 MPa, and the temperature reaches 115℃;

[0058] 56-120 min, maintain temperature and pressure for 65 minutes;

[0059] 121-180 minutes, release the pressure and lower the temperature to room temperature;

[0060] The rest is the same as in Example 1, to obtain a bulletproof curved panel.

[0061] Comparative Example 1

[0062] Polybenzobisoxazole, a microfiber material, was selected as the dent reduction material, and the rest was the same as in Example 1 to obtain a bulletproof curved panel.

[0063] Comparative Example 2

[0064] An epoxy dicyclopentadiene epoxy wetting agent was used instead of a hot melt adhesive film, and the rest was the same as in Example 1.

[0065] Comparative Example 3

[0066] Step (3) uses autoclave molding technology, and the rest is the same as in Example 1.

[0067] The surface density of the bulletproof curved panels obtained in Examples 1-5 and Comparative Examples 1-3, the number of M80 bullets they resisted, and the dent distance are statistically shown in Table 1 below.

[0068] Table 1. Test Results of Bulletproof Curved Panels

[0069]

[0070] Based on the test results of the bulletproof curved panels above, the bulletproof curved panel obtained by selecting polybenzobisoxazole microfiber material as the dent reduction material has a higher surface density than that of Example 1, and the dent distance resisted by 6 M80 bullets is also increased; the bulletproof curved panel obtained by using epoxy dicyclopentadiene epoxy impregnating agent instead of hot melt adhesive film has a higher surface density than that of Example 1, and the dent distance resisted by 6 M80 bullets is also increased; the difference in surface density between the bulletproof curved panels of Comparative Example 3 and Example 1 indicates that the most suitable method for manufacturing the bulletproof curved panel of this application is to use a four-column hydraulic press.
